titleOfInvention | Method and apparatus for channel coding and decoding for modulation schemes and memory |
abstract | For transferring digital information in the form of consecutive symbols from antransmitter over a transmission channel susceptible for intersymbolninterference to a receiver, the following steps are taken in succession:n a) encoding the digital information to be transmitted with an outer code (202), b) interleaving the encoded digital information to be transmitted (203), c) encoding the interleaved encoded digital information with a recursive innerncode (204) and in conjunction therewith modulating the encoded interleavednencoded digital information onto a carrier (205), d) transmitting the carrier containing the modulated encoded interleavednencoded digital information, e) receiving the transmitted carrier containing the modulated encodedninterleaved encoded digital information, f) producing an estimate of the characteristics of the transmission channeln(208), g) converting the received carrier into consecutive symbols in a SISOnequalisation process using the produced estimate of the characteristics of thentransmission channel (209), h) deinterleaving the consecutive symbols (210), and i) decoding the deinterleaved consecutive symbols in a SISO decodingnprocess (211). |
